  • Phospholipase A2

    Enzyme that selectively cleaves unsaturated fatty acids at the 2-position of phospholipids, impacting membrane fluidity.
  • Phospholipid

    Molecule with a phosphate-containing head and two fatty acid tails, forming the structural basis of cellular membranes.
  • Ester Bond

    Chemical linkage connecting fatty acids to the glycerol backbone in phospholipids, crucial for membrane structure.
  • Unsaturated Fatty Acid

    Hydrocarbon chain with one or more double bonds, often found at the 2-position in phospholipids, enhancing membrane flexibility.
  • Integral Membrane Protein

    Protein embedded within the membrane, possessing both hydrophobic and hydrophilic regions, requiring detergents for extraction.
  • Detergent

    Amphipathic molecule used to solubilize membrane proteins by interacting with their hydrophobic regions.
  • Hydrophobic Region

    Nonpolar segment of a molecule, typically found within the membrane interior, repelling water.
  • Hydrophilic Region

    Polar segment of a molecule, often exposed to aqueous environments, attracting water.
  • Membrane-Spanning Helix

    Alpha-helical segment, usually about 20 amino acids long, traversing the lipid bilayer of membranes.
  • Flippase

    Enzyme facilitating movement of phospholipids from the outer to the inner leaflet, maintaining membrane asymmetry.
  • Floppase

    Enzyme responsible for transferring phospholipids from the inner to the outer leaflet of the membrane.
  • Scramblase

    Enzyme enabling bidirectional movement of phospholipids across membrane leaflets, disrupting asymmetry.
  • Leaflet

    One of the two layers of phospholipids forming the bilayer structure of cellular membranes.
  • Mole Ratio

    Quantitative comparison of the number of moles of lipids to proteins in a membrane, calculated using mass and molecular weight.
  • Molecular Weight

    Mass of a molecule expressed in Daltons, used to determine mole ratios in membrane composition analysis.
